Home to 1,305 residents, Donderstraat is a dense urban neighbourhood in Gooise Meren. Measured against every neighbourhood in the Netherlands, it scores 9.7 out of 10. The profile is pronounced: socio-economic position scores 9.9, while nature and quiet lags at 2.8. Housing sits in the upper segment, with an average property value of €783k versus €422k nationally.

Frequently asked questions

How is the grade for Donderstraat calculated?

Donderstraat scores 9.7 overall. That is a weighted average of five pillars: safety, amenities, housing, social & income, and nature & quiet. Each pillar compares this neighbourhood with every other neighbourhood in the Netherlands, using open data from CBS and the police.

Is Donderstraat a safe neighbourhood?

Donderstraat scores 5.1 on safety, based on registered crimes per 1,000 people present (21.8 per year). The national median is around 24.1.
